Hyundai Ioniq 6 First Edition: 2500 copies
Pre-orders for the Hyundai Ioniq 6 First Edition started on November 9, 2022 in Europe, in the strategic markets of electric cars: Germany, Great Britain, Norway, the Netherlands and France. In general, 2500 copies were planned, while in France this special edition was launched limited to 250 unitsoffered at a price of 62,500 euros.
Customers who were unable to reserve the Ioniq 6 First Edition will soon receive a commercial offer from their dealer. The full line of Hyundai Ioniq 6 will be presented before the end of the year, and buyers of the First Edition version will receive the first ones from March to April 2023.

Hyundai Ioniq 6 First Edition: special launch series
The Hyundai Ioniq 6 First Edition distinguished by exclusive equipment that includes 20-inch wheels with a matte black finish or stylish moldings painted in gloss black on the front, rear, sides and mirrors. Aluminum Hyundai logos are painted black on the front bumper and trunk, contrasting with the four exterior colors offered as standard on this special edition: Biophilic Blue Pearl, Serenity White Pearl, Nocturne Gray Metallic and Gravity Gold Matte.
On board there is a black interior, which is combined with a sporty black headliner. The seats received two-material upholstery made of leather and gray tartan fabric, inspired by the Hyundai Prophecy electric concept car. The recycled Econyl mats also feature matching gray tartan inserts and are signed ‘First Edition’.
Hyundai Ioniq 6 First Edition: full range
If the Hyundai Ioniq 6 First Edition has all-wheel drive, as well as a battery capacity 77.4 kWhwhich allows you to offer up to The range is 614 km According to the WLTP mixed cycle, Hyundai’s range of all-electric sedans will offer more options.
Indeed, several trim levels will be offered, as well as a choice of 53kWh and 77.4kWh batteries, linked to single- or dual-motor configurations, thus offering two- or four-wheel drive transmissions. Depending on the version, power consumption starts at 13.9 kWh/100 km, the range varies from 429 to 614 km. The most powerful version, with two motors and four-wheel drive, boasts a capacity of 325 horsepower at 605 Nm of torquewhich allows it to accelerate from 0 to 100 km/h in 5.1 seconds.
